Speech and Language Pathologist Responsibilities
  • Evaluate and diagnose students' communication, including articulation, fluency, voice, and language disorders.
  • Create and manage measurable goals/objectives for students’ intervention plans.
  • Collaborate with other service providers on the multi‑disciplinary team.
  • Provide high‑quality speech‑language therapy service to students.
  • Select and/or prepare speech‑language instructional materials.
  • Provide carryover activities for students, teams, and families.
  • Keep current with professional literature and attend seminars regularly to maintain and update professional skills (lifelong learning).
  • Write and maintain confidential client case notes and reports, and share information with students and other professionals.
  • Maintain a safe and clean working environment by complying with procedures, rules, and regulations.
